Transaction 13143abcb166974982fb9deaa7df18aed268205d83c391c00ef19cf1c344f73e
1 Input
1 Output
-
13143abcb166974982fb9deaa7df18aed268205d83c391c00ef19cf1c344f73e:0
- value
- 89000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5d3f4cb022e571ea375d8ca729d74384912ffdaf OP_EQUAL
- address
- 3AC4bWohXHtAucHD6xtW3qPn7oA3UosRKW